I got bored today and decided to make a CAI for the twins. It's all purge welded 316L Stainless. Now that the intake is out in front of the bumper, I can try out the Co2 spraybar I also madehttp://www.youtube.com/watch?v=rSI24qxCOsw while going down the track.

5" could fit, but the plastic inner wheel well would be a lil tweeked. This one is 4", and moves the wheel well about 1/4", with a 1/4" gap between the tube/rad support. Horn and light wires were re routed as well. If I had exact dimensions/location of the turndown on your truck it could happen.
